Ascitic Fluid in Ovarian Mass with Special Reference to Paired-box Gene 8 Immunoexpression: A Cross-sectional Analysis
Introduction: Mortality in the case of ovarian malignancy is high due to late diagnosis. Early and accurate diagnosis can improve case-specific management.
